Orion's belt sent on 24 Gennaio 2026 (9:49) by Dario Quattrin. 6 comments, 169 views.

Ultimo lavoro, quasi 8 ore di dati e altrettante di postproduzione ... Potete ammirare da sinistra a destra la cintura di Orione con le tre stelle Alnitak, Alnilam e Mintaka. Accanto a Alnitak troviamo a sx la nebulosa Fiamma NGC2024 e a dx la Testa di cavallo B33. In basso a destra le due nebulose Running man e M42. Per i fotografi il campo inquadrato corrisponde al campo di un 180mm su apsc.
